About 6-bromo-4-chloro-2-ethoxy-8-fluoroquinazoline
6-bromo-4-chloro-2-ethoxy-8-fluoroquinazoline (PubChem CID 138958342) has the molecular formula C10H7BrClFN2O
and a molecular weight of 305.53 g/mol. Its IUPAC name is 6-bromo-4-chloro-2-ethoxy-8-fluoroquinazoline.
